/*
@test
@key headful
@bug 4092033 4529626
@summary Tests that toFront makes window focused unless it is non-focusable
@library ../../regtesthelpers
@build Util
@run main ToFrontFocus
*/
import java.awt.*;
import java.awt.event.*;
import test.java.awt.regtesthelpers.Util;
public class ToFrontFocus {
Frame cover, focus_frame, nonfocus_frame;
Button focus_button, nonfocus_button;
volatile boolean focus_gained = false, nonfocus_gained = false;
public static void main(final String[] args) {
ToFrontFocus app = new ToFrontFocus();
app.init();
app.start();
}
public void init()
{
cover = new Frame("Cover frame");
cover.setBounds(100, 100, 200, 200);
focus_frame = new Frame("Focusable frame");
focus_frame.setBounds(150, 100, 250, 150);
nonfocus_frame = new Frame("Non-focusable frame");
nonfocus_frame.setFocusableWindowState(false);
nonfocus_frame.setBounds(150, 150, 250, 200);
focus_button = new Button("Button in focusable frame");
focus_button.addFocusListener(new FocusAdapter() {
public void focusGained(FocusEvent e) {
focus_gained = true;
}
});
nonfocus_button = new Button("Button in non-focusable frame");
nonfocus_button.addFocusListener(new FocusAdapter() {
public void focusGained(FocusEvent e) {
nonfocus_gained = true;
}
});
}//End init()
public void start ()
{
Util.waitForIdle(null);
focus_frame.setFocusTraversalPolicy(new DefaultFocusTraversalPolicy() {
public Component getInitialComponent(Window w) {
return null;
}
});
focus_frame.setVisible(true);
nonfocus_frame.setFocusTraversalPolicy(new DefaultFocusTraversalPolicy() {
public Component getInitialComponent(Window w) {
return null;
}
});
nonfocus_frame.setVisible(true);
cover.setVisible(true);
Util.waitForIdle(null);
// So events are no generated at the creation add buttons here.
focus_frame.add(focus_button);
focus_frame.pack();
focus_frame.setFocusTraversalPolicy(new DefaultFocusTraversalPolicy() {
public Component getInitialComponent(Window w) {
return focus_button;
}
});
nonfocus_frame.add(nonfocus_button);
nonfocus_frame.pack();
nonfocus_frame.setFocusTraversalPolicy(new DefaultFocusTraversalPolicy() {
public Component getInitialComponent(Window w) {
return nonfocus_button;
}
});
System.err.println("------------ Starting test ------------");
// Make frame focused - focus_gained will be genereated for button.
focus_frame.toFront();
// focus_gained should not be generated
nonfocus_frame.toFront();
// Wait for events.
Util.waitForIdle(null);
if (!focus_gained || nonfocus_gained) {
throw new RuntimeException("ToFront doesn't work as expected");
}
}// start()
}// class ToFrontFocus
